> 1. Items sent as regular or occasional emails
> =20
>
> 1.1 Email list serves and forums
> The ones listed here usually send out about 5-10 text-only emails each =
> week without attachments.
>
> =20
>
> 'HIF-net at WHO' (Health Information Forum-net at World Health =
> Organization)
>
> HIF-net at WHO is a free email discussion list provided as part of an =
> integrated package of communication tools for the 'international health =
> information community'. It is dedicated to issues of health information =
> access in resource-poor settings and aims to promote multidisciplinary =
> communication among providers and users of health information. There are =
> presently around 1500 participants including health professionals, =
> librarians and publishers. HIF-net at WHO is a good place to announce =
> new materials to professionals outside the nutrition community and to =
> discuss issues related to the sharing of nutrition information. HIF-net =
> at WHO does not send attachments.
>
> =20
>
> To join the list, send an email to health at inasp.info with your name, =
> organisation, country, and brief description of professional interests.=20
>
>
> HIF-net at WHO is organised by the International Network for the =
> Availability of Scientific Publications (INASP). INASP-Health also runs =
> the Health Information Forum, a series of meetings held in the UK for =
> everyone working to improve access to information for health workers in =
> low-income countries. INASP-Health provides other services including =
> INASP-Health Advisory and Liaison service, INASP-Health Directory, (an =
> on-line reference and networking tool giving details of international =
> health information support programmes) and INASP Health Links (see under =
> 4. below). For more details visit www.inasp.info/health/.
>
> =20
>
> ProNut-HIV
> Pronut-HIV is a free email forum that aims to share up-to-date =
> information, knowledge and experiences on nutrition and HIV/AIDS. It =
> does not send attachments.=20
>
> =20
>
> To join email pronut-hiv-join at healthnet.org. When subscribing the =
> subject and body of the message will be ignored, so it does not matter =
> what you put there. When you receive a confirmation message, you must =
> reply to it to complete your subscription request. You may also join by =
> visiting the web site =
> http://list.healthnet.org/mailman/listinfo/pronut-hiv or via =
> www.pronutrition.org. To send a message to ProNut-HIV email =
> pronut-hiv at healthnet.org. Information and archives are at =
> http://www.pronutrition.org.=20
>
> =20
>
> Pronut-HIV is a collaboration between SATELLIFE and the Academy for =
> Educational Development (AED).

> 1.2 Email announcements of publications, meetings, etc.
> =20
>
> *Arbor Clinical Nutrition Updates
> Arbor Clinical Nutrition Updates, a service of the Arbor Nutrition =
> Guide, sends free regular reviews of research findings related to =
> nutrition to health professionals and students. They are available in =
> English, Spanish, Portuguese, French, Russian, Korean and Japanese. The =
> item reviewed is also sent as an attachment in Acrobat Adobe so can be =
> quite long (e.g. 180KB).
>
> =20
>
> To receive the Clinical Nutrition Updates go to the website =
> http://arborcom.com or send an email to update at arbor.com. Include =
> details of your name, email address, the country where you live, the =
> institution you are associated with (if relevant) and your professional =
> background.=20
>
> =20
>
> The Arbor Nutrition Guide site at http://arborcom.com has a good search =
> engine and links to thousands of nutrition-related sites (some being =
> presently updated) including more list serves.
>
> =20
>
> Baby Milk Action mailing list
> Baby Milk Action is the UK member of the International Baby Food Action =
> Network =AD IBFAN (see below). The mailing list sends occasional alerts =
> when there is new information on the Baby Milk Action website - =
> http://www.babymilkaction.org/. It does not send attachments.
>
> To subscribe email info at babymilkaction.org or complete the contact form =
> at http://www.babymilkaction.org/pages/contact.html.
>
>
>
> FAO Publications (FAO-BOOKINFO)
> FAO Publications sends out regular announcements of its latest =
> publications under topic headings of which 'Nutrition' is one. It does =
> not send attachments. Titles together with a short description are given =
> in the language of the publication.=20
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e email mailserv at mailserv.fao.org, leave the subject blank =
> and then put the following in the first line of the message: subscribe =
> FAO-Bookinfo-L. The HTML version of FAO-BOOKINFO is available on-line at =
> http://www.fao.org/catalog/bullettin/last.htm
>
> =20
>
> Food Security on the Development Gateway
> Food Security on the Development Gateway sends regular updates on =
> publications related to food security. Members of the list can customise =
> the content and frequency of what they receive. It does not send =
> attachments.
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e go to =
> http://topics.developmentgateway.org/um~user/showUserRegister.do. To see =
> archives and to request documents by email go to =
> http://topics.developmentgateway.org/foodsecurity
>
>
>
> International Baby Food Action Network (IBFAN) mailing list
> The IBFAN mailing lists sends alerts when new information (available in =
> several languages) is posted on its website http://www.ibfan.org. This =
> includes 'Breastfeeding Briefs' (see Information Sheet 1), reports from =
> working groups and results of monitoring baby food companies. It does =
> not send attachments.
>
> To subscribe complete the contact form on the website (e.g. for English =
> go to http://www.ibfan.org/english/contact/contactalert)
>
> =20
>
> id21 HealthNews
> id21HealthNews is a free e-newsletter that gives the latest research and =
> news on health issues in developing countries. It gives a brief abstract =
> of each item and a link to the full item on the id21 website =
> (www.id21.org). Email copies of the full item can be requested. It does =
> not send attachments.
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e send an email to lyris at lyris.ids.ac.uk, with the message: =
> "subscribe id21HealthNews Firstname Lastname", e.g. "subscribe =
> id21HealthNews Emily Smith". For problems or queries contact: =
> id21 at ids.ac.uk. To get free hard copies of 'insights health', id21's =
> annual print review of health research in developing countries, email =
> your full postal address to id21subscriptions at ids.ac.uk quoting =
> "insights health" and stating how many free copies you would like to =
> receive. Back issues of 'insights health' are available at =
> http://www.id21.org/insights/index.html.=20
>
> =20
>
> id21 is enabled by the UK Department for International Development and =
> hosted by the Institute of Development Studies at the University of =
> Sussex.=20
>
> =20
>
> Lists hosted by the International Food Policy Research Institute (IFPRI)
> a. NEWatIFPRI=20
> NEWatIFPRI is an email announcement-only list that updates subscribers =
> with the latest information available on the IFPRI website =
> (www.ifpri.org). It is sent out once or twice a month and does not send =
> attachments.=20
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e, go to http://www.ifpri.org/new/NEWatIFPRI.htm.=20
>
> =20
>
> b. IFPRI-TCSP (Training for Capacity Strengthening Program) List Serve=20
> IFPRI-TCSP List Serve sends monthly emails giving information about =
> capacity strengthening opportunities in food, agriculture, nutrition, =
> and natural resource policy in developed and developing countries. It =
> disseminates information about training materials and training methods, =
> announcements regarding fellowships and scholarships, and relevant =
> upcoming capacity strengthening events. It does not send attachments.=20
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e to the list send an email to LISTSERV at CGNET.COM. In the =
> body of the message write SUBSCRIBE IFPRI-STPC <your email address>. To =
> send an item for inclusion in the monthly newsletter, email =
> v.rhoe at cgiar.org. Visit the website at =
> http://www.ifpri.org/training/train_newsletter.htm
>
> =20
>
> c. IFPRIEastAfricaNetwork=20
>
> IFPRIEastAfricaNetwork is the e-mail list server for the IFPRI Eastern =
> Africa Food Policy Network, which sends messages and announcements to =
> its subscribers. Its goal is to provide information on food security, =
> poverty alleviation, and natural resource management, and to facilitate =
> communication among researchers and policy makers in Eastern Africa. All =
> subscribers can use the list server: to share information on ongoing =
> research and research findings, on policies enacted and on new =
> publications; to announce meetings and training activities; as a =
> discussion forum for issues related to food, agriculture and the =
> environment in eastern Africa; to request assistance in locating =
> additional relevant information. It does not send attachments.
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e email IFPRI-EastAfrica at ifpri.bushnet.net giving your name, =
> occupation, organisation you are affiliated with, and your interest in =
> food, agriculture and the environment in Eastern Africa. To post a =
> message, email IFPRIEastAfricaNetwork at cgiar.org. The website is at =
> http://www.ifpri.org/2020/nw/intro.htm=20
>
>
> New at ICDDRB (New at International Centre for Diarhoeal Diseases =
> Research, Bangladesh)
> New at ICDDRB sends regular emails listing the contents of 'Journal of =
> Health, Population and Nutrition' which is published by ICDDR,B: Centre =
> for Health and Population Research. The full text of each article in the =
> journal and other ICDDR,B  publications are on =
> http://www.icddrb.org/pub/index.jsp . It does not send attachments.
>
> =20
>
> To subscribe go to http://www.icddrb.org/pub/index.jsp or =
> http://topica.com/lists/ICDDRBNews@topica.com=20
>
> =20
>
> Nutrition News for Africa
> Nutrition News for Africa sends out a bi-monthly state-of-the-art =
> research or policy paper (in English, French, and Portuguese) on =
> Africa-related public health nutrition topics. The email gives an =
> abstract and the full article as an Adobe Acrobat attachment (which can =
> be long e.g. 150 - 350KB)). Nutrition News for Africa is sent courtesy =
> of Helen Keller International (www.hki.org).
>
> =20
>
> To receive these articles send an email to Micheline Ntiru =
> mntiru at mweb.co.za giving your name, title, and electronic address.=20
>
> =20
>
> The Pop Reporter
> The Pop Reporter emails regular bulletins on health and development =
> issues giving the website on which items are posted together with the =
> first few sentences of the item. One can choose the type of topics =
> received. It does not send attachments.
>
> =20
>
> To join go to http://prds.infoforhealth.org/signup.php. To have an item =
> considered for inclusion in The Pop Reporter email the URL and =
> description to rjacoby at jhuccp.org. Archives are at =
> http://www.infoforhealth.org/popreporter/.
>
>
> The Pop Reporter is a project of Johns Hopkins Bloomberg School of =
> Public Health/Center for Communication Programs.=20

> 2. Web-based forums
> =20
> *NutritionNet
> NutritionNet provides a controlled platform for debate about new =
> concepts, practices and challenges particularly in the field of =
> emergency nutrition. To learn more and to register visit =
> http://www.nutritionnet.net and/or email Saskia.vd.kam at nutritionnet.nl
>
> =20
> 3. Advisory services
> =20
> Iron Deficiency Project Advisory Service (IDPAS)
> IDPAS provides technical information on iron deficiency anaemia and iron =
> nutrition to workers in developing countries and countries in =
> transition. IDPAS has a large up-to-date fully searchable documentation =
> collection including over 2000 references, many linked to full text =
> documents. IDPAS also quickly responds to requests for information via =
> email or other channels on a wide range of technical and program and =
> public health areas related to iron and other micronutrients.
>
>
> To register, visit IDPAS at the Micronutrient Initiative's website =
> http://www.micronutrient.org/idpas or email idpas at inffoundation.org.
>
> =20
>
> IDPAS also produces the CD-ROM "Iron World" - for details see the =
> Nutrition Society's Information Sheet 3 =
> (www.nutritionsociety.org/careers/studentsinfo). IDPAS is a project of =
> the International Nutrition Foundation.

> 4. Websites giving access to online journals
> =20
>
> African Health Sciences
>
> All back issues (up to 1 year) of African Health Sciences (published by =
> Makerere University Medical School, Uganda) are available free online. =
> To access the journal go to =
> http://www.extenza-eps.com/extenza/contentviewing/viewJournalIssueTOC.do?=
> issueId=3D2242 For more information and to subscribe to the journal =
> email the editor, James Tumwine, jtumwine at imul.com=20
>
> =20
>
> *African Journal of Food, Agriculture, Nutrition and Development =
> (AJFAND)
> AJFAND is a free on-line-only journal published in Kenya. To access the =
> journal go to www.ajfand.net. To get email alerts of new issues email =
> Ruth Oniang'o at oniango at iconnect.co.ke
>
> =20
>
> African Journals OnLine (AJOL)
> The AJOL website (http://www.ajol.info) provides free access to tables =
> of contents and abstracts for about 200 African journals (which includes =
> ones on medicine, agriculture and nutrition). AJOL also offers a =
> document delivery service, and full searching and browsing facilities, =
> as well as an email alert function. The service is free to both users =
> and participating journals (with charges only for document delivery =
> requests from outside developing countries).
>
> =20
>
> AGORA - Access to Global Online Research in Agriculture
> AGORA provides free or very low cost online access to over 400 major =
> journals in agriculture and related sciences (including some nutrition =
> journals, e.g. Public Health Nutrition, Nutrition Research Reviews, =
> Proceedings of the Nutrition Society, British Journal of Nutrition) to =
> registered public institutions in many developing countries.=20
>
> =20
>
> To register log on to http://www.aginternetwork.org/en/=20
>
> =20
>
> AGORA is an initiative managed by the Food and Agriculture Organization =
> of the United Nations.
>
> The Cochrane Library
>  The Cochrane Library is a regularly updated electronic resource =
> designed to give the necessary evidence for informed healthcare =
> decision-making. It includes The Cochrane Database of Systematic =
> Reviews, which is a rapidly growing collection of regularly updated =
> systematic reviews of the effects of health care interventions. The =
> Cochrane Library is published on CD-ROM four times a year. About 50 =
> reviews are added every 3 months.=20
>
> =20
>
> Visit the library at http://www.cochrane.org and the Database at =
> http://www.cochrane.org/cochrane/revabstr/newreviews.htm. For more =
> information contact  secretariat at cochrane.org
> =20
>
> enLINK - the Nestle Foundation e-library for Nutrition and Nutrition =
> Research=20
> enLINK is an on-line collection of key international  nutrition =
> journals. The site is easy to search. Users in several developing =
> countries can 'register' and then can obtain the full text of each =
> journal. Users in other countries can retrieve abstracts.=20
>
> =20
>
> To visit enLINK log on to http://www.enLINK.org.
>
> =20
>
> enLINK is an initiative of the Nestle Foundation. Further information =
> from Paolo Suter nestle.foundation at vtxnet.ch=20
>
> =20
>
> *Directory of Open Access Journals (DOAJ)
> Directory of Open Access Journals contains information about more than =
> 1100 open access journals, (i.e. quality controlled scientific and =
> scholarly electronic journals that are freely available on the web). =
> Topics include Medicine (109 journals) and Public Health (41 journals of =
> which at least one is on nutrition). Users can search for articles in =
> potentially all Open Access Journals. The goal of DOAJ is to increase =
> the visibility and accessibility of open access scholarly journals and =
> to cover all open access scholarly journals that use an appropriate =
> quality control system. To find out more visit http://www.doaj.org or =
> contact Lotte Jorgensen  lotte.jorgensen at lub.lu.se or Lars Bjornshauge =
> lars.bjornshauge at lub.lu.se=20
> The DOAJ is funded by the Information Program of the Open Society =
> Institute http://www.osi.hu/infoprogram/ and Lund University Libraries, =
> and supported by SPARC (The Scholarly Publishing and Academic Resources =
> Coalition,
> (http://www.arl.org/sparc) and BIBSAM (the Royal Library of Sweden).
>
>
>
> HINARI - Health InterNetwork Access to Research Initiative
> HINARI provides free or very low cost online access to one of the =
> world's largest collection of biomedical and health journals (including =
> about 18 nutrition journals, e.g. Public Health Nutrition, Nutrition =
> Research Reviews, Proceedings of the Nutrition Society, British Journal =
> of Nutrition) to registered local non-profit institutions in developing =
> countries. Abstracts of articles are available to all users without =
> registration.=20
>
> =20
>
> To visit HINARI or to register log on to =
> http://www.healthinternetwork.org/scipub.php and/or =
> http://www.healthinternetwork.org/src/eligibility.php or contact the =
> HINARI Team at hinari at who.int.=20
>
> =20
>
> HINARI is an initiative set up by WHO together with major publishers.
>
> =20
> INASP Health Links
> The ' International Network for the Availability of Scientific =
> Publications (INASP) Health Links' gateway has several pages that note =
> options for access to fulltext books and journals via the Internet. =
> These include:
>
> Fulltext E-Books http://www.inasp.info/health/links/ebooks.html=20
>
> Full text E-Journals: http://www.inasp.info/health/links/ejrlsdir.html=20
>
> Fulltext E-Newsletters, Reviews and Factsheets: =
> http://www.inasp.info/health/links/eotherdir.html=20
>
> Nutrition is listed as a topic and all the links selected give =
> additional links to many other useful websites and publications.
>
> =20
>
> Also, the Information for Development page: =
> http://www.inasp.info/health/links/infodevt.html has links to several =
> sites relating to the subject of 'open access' including the Digital =
> Dividend Project Clearinghouse and Licensing Digital Information: =
> Developing Nations Clearinghouse. The pages give a good overview of what =
> is available via the Internet but requires fast and cost effective =
> access to this tool.
>
> =20
> PERI  - Programme for the Enhancement of research Information
> PERI is managed by the International Network for the Availability of =
> Scientific Publications (INASP) (see above) and, among other things, =
> provides free or affordable access to many full-text online journals, =
> databases and document delivery services for researchers in developing =
> and transitional countries.=20
>
> =20
>
> To visit PERI and find out more go to www.inasp.info/peri/ and =
> www.inasp.info/peri/resources.html.
>
> =20
>
> *World Health Organization Library database (WHOLIS)=20
> WHOLIS at http://www.who.int/library/database/index.en.shtml indexes all =
> the published information produced by WHO, and has links to the =
> full-text of 21,000 documents in several languages.
>
> =20
>
> Items marked with a * indicate those who did not reply when asked for =
> their entry to be checked - however the sites have been visited and all =
> were 'working' in Summer 2004.
>
> =20
>
> TALC (Teaching aids At Low Cost) CD-ROM
> TALC produces a free CD-ROM on Health and Development 2-3 times a year. =
> The CD contains INASP Health Links and the Cochrane Reviews, as well as =
> other material, some of which is directly related to nutrition. Using =
> this CD can save a considerable amount of time 'on-line'. To receive the =
> TALC CD email info at talcuk.org giving your name, organisation and =
> position and postal address or visit www.talcuk.org
